Anthracnose diseases of some common medicinally important fruit plants

Anup Kumar Sarkar

Anthracnose, caused by Colletotrichum sp. is a relatively common disease of many medicinally important fruit plants. The anthracnose pathogen is rather unique in that this fungus can infect virtually all parts of the plants. It is more problematic as it harms ripe fruits, even after the harvest. Thus a huge loss is faced during storage and transport. This review peers into the pathological symptoms and mode of disease spreading of anthracnose of some common medicinally important fruit plants including Mango, Papaya, Olive and Banana.
